Vestal Residents To Vote On New Rescue Truck

SHARE NOW

Vestal residents will soon be voting on whether the town’s fire department will purchase a rescue truck. Five months ago, voters rejected an attempt to replace a 27-year-old rescue truck, but now the town board voted unanimously to propose a less-expensive option for residents to vote on. The previous vote asked voters to approve borrowing up to $800,000 for a new rescue truck, but the new proposal asks to borrow about $675,000 for the new truck.
